Income Tax—Company—Profits which might reasonably have been distributed— yy ©, oF A. Determination of Commissioner of Taxation—Communication to taxpayer— 1995, Right of taxpayer to be heard—Board of Appeal—Validity of legislation—Income Tax Assessment Act 1922 (No. 37 of 1922), sec. 21. Metnouryr,
Held, by Knox C.J., Higgins and Starke JJ., that the word " determination" June 2, 16. in see, 21 (1) of the Income Tax Assessment Act 1922 implies a communication
i eee is knox CF of 1 jsaacs, Higgins, of the determination to the taxpayer. ace, Hig Starke JJ.
Per Isaacs and Rich JJ.:—(1) Sub-sec. 5 of sec, 21 of that Act is invalid for the reasons stated in British Imperial Oil Co. v. Federal Commissioner of Taxation, (1925) 35 C.L.R. 422, and, therefore, where a taxpayer is dissatisfied with the Commissioner's decision there is no additional tax; but that sub- section is severable, and where a taxpayer is not so dissatisfied the rest of the section operates. (2) In order to constitute a valid determination of the Commissioner under sec, 21 (1) it is not necessary that the taxpayer shall have been heard.
